Key Factors to Consider When Choosing a Chocolate Hamper
When selecting a hamper, think of it as assembling a Swiss army knife of gifting—each component must serve a purpose.
- Quality of Chocolate: Premium ingredients and reputable chocolatiers signal respect. Variety and Dietary Options: Include dark, milk, and possibly vegan or nut‑free selections. Packaging and Presentation: Look for sturdy boxes, tasteful designs, and customizable branding. Budget and Quantity: Match the hamper size to the occasion and your financial plan.
Quality of Chocolate
Premium chocolate not only tastes better but also reflects your brand’s standards. Opt for chocolates with high cocoa percentages, ethically sourced beans, or artisanal craftsmanship. Variety and Dietary Options
Corporate audiences are diverse. Including a range of flavors and dietary-friendly options—like dark chocolate for the health‑conscious or dairy‑free bars for vegans—shows inclusivity. It’s the corporate equivalent of offering both coffee and tea at a meeting.

Packaging and Presentation
A hamper’s exterior is the first impression. Look for:
- Sturdy construction: Avoid flimsy boxes that collapse under a courier’s weight. Elegant aesthetics: Metallic accents or matte finishes can elevate perceived value. Branding space: Ensure there’s room for your logo or a personalized message.
Budget and Quantity
Large hampers can feel like a luxury, but they’re not always necessary. A modest yet carefully curated selection can sometimes convey more thoughtfulness than a bulkier version. Align the hamper’s size with the event’s significance and your budget.
Top Chocolate Hamper Picks for Different Corporate Needs
Choosing the right hamper depends on the audience and the occasion. Below are tailored suggestions.
Executive‑Grade Hampers
These are the “black‑tie” gifts for top executives. Look for:
- High‑cocoa dark chocolate with exotic flavor notes. Gold‑foil packaging or custom embossed logos. Accompanying accessories like a premium tin or a small chocolate‑themed desk accessory.
Team‑Building Hampers
For internal morale boosts, choose a variety that encourages sharing:
- Assorted chocolate bars: From classic milk to spicy chili. Snack‑size portions for easy office consumption. Motivational quotes printed on the packaging.
Client Appreciation Hampers
When you want to say “thank you” to a client, balance elegance with practicality:
- Premium chocolate truffles paired with a small bottle of wine or a branded mug. Seasonal flavors that align with the time of year. Personalized thank‑you notes that reference past collaborations.
Seasonal and Holiday Hampers
Celebrate holidays with themed selections:
- Christmas: Red‑wrapped chocolate bars, peppermint bark, and a festive ribbon. Valentine’s Day: Heart‑shaped chocolates, rose‑infused truffles. Easter: Chocolate eggs with playful packaging.
How to Personalize Your Chocolate Hamper
Personalization turns a generic gift into a memorable experience.
Custom Labels and Branding
Add a custom label that features your company’s logo, a short message, or the recipient’s name. It’s a subtle yet powerful reminder of the relationship.
Add a Personal Note
A handwritten note can make the difference between a good gift and a great one. Keep it brief, sincere, and relevant to the recipient’s role.
Choosing the Right Delivery Timing
Timing can amplify impact. Deliver the hamper:
- At the end of a successful project. On a client’s anniversary with your company. During a holiday season to align with the festive mood.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Choosing low‑quality chocolate: It undermines the gift’s perceived value. Neglecting dietary restrictions: Overlooks inclusivity. Overloading the hamper with too many items: Can feel cluttered. Ignoring brand consistency: The packaging should reflect your brand’s tone.
